quote:

How are Hawaii and South Alabama ahead of Vandy in APR?


Has nothing to do with APR. Both, along with Army have special circumstances. Key word is "and".

Army, South Alabama, and the best APR teams with 5-7 records will qualify if not all teams win. Hawaii will also qualify if they win their final game and there are not enough bowl eligible teams.

^ Army is 6–5 with two wins over Football Championship Subdivision opponents. Only one win counts toward bowl eligibility. Army can be officially eligible by winning final game vs. Navy. Army will qualify for a bowl with a 6–6 record only if there are unfilled bowl berths.

^ South Alabama is 5–5 with two wins over Football Championship Subdivision opponents. Only one FCS win counts toward bowl eligibility. South Alabama can be officially eligible by winning final two games. South Alabama will qualify for a bowl with a 6–6 record only if there are unfilled bowl berths.
